Small-business copier leases around Olmsted run $100-$400 a month in 2026 market data - light-volume machines $50-$189, mid-volume $150-$375 - and the number to compare is the 60-month total, not the payment.

Most copier leases offered in Olmsted carry an automatic-renewal clause: miss the written-notice window, commonly 90 days before term end, and the contract renews itself for another 12 months.

The 2026 numbers

Equipment category2026 market rangeThe number that actually matters
Copier / MFP lease (small business)$100-$400/monthThe 60-month total plus the service agreement - not the payment
Copier service (cost per copy)$0.01-$0.015 per page B&W; $0.06-$0.12 per page colorMinimum page billing and 5-10% annual escalators change the real rate
Forklift - new$22,000-$55,000Electric adds a battery/charger budget; duty cycle picks the powertrain
Forklift - used / rental$12,000-$25,000 used; $180-$400/day rentalRental is the honest answer for seasonal peaks
Office coffee service$5-$14 per person/monthThe 'free machine' is real - the margin is in the coffee
Equipment financing (2026)7-25% APR typical rangeWell-qualified borrowers commonly see 9-15% - quote the financing too
Section 179 expensing (2026)up to $2,560,000Phases out above $4,090,000; state rules may differ - see below
For tax years beginning in 2026 the Section 179 expensing limit is $2,560,000 with a $4,090,000 phase-out threshold, and 100% bonus depreciation applies permanently to qualifying equipment acquired and placed in service after January 19, 2025.Source: IRS Rev. Proc. 2025-32 (Section 179 2026 inflation adjustments); copier lease and cost-per-copy market ranges per 1800 Office Solutions 2026 market data; forklift, coffee-service and financing ranges per industry sources catalogued in this site's research file

Common questions

Does my state tax equipment leases?

Most states apply sales tax to each lease payment, a few tax the deal upfront, and a handful have no sales tax at all - while cities can stack their own lease taxes on top (Chicago's is the famous one). The state's treatment and official source are on this page; it can move a real monthly cost by several percent.

How much does a forklift cost?

New internal-combustion units run about $22,000-$50,000 and new electrics $25,000-$55,000 - plus roughly $10,000-$20,000 for the battery and charger. Solid used machines trade around $12,000-$25,000. Rentals run about $180-$400 a day or $450-$900 a week, which is often the honest answer for seasonal peaks.

Is a $1 buyout lease better than an FMV lease?

They are different products: a $1-buyout lease is financing a purchase - you own the machine at term end and pay roughly 20% more per month for the privilege; an FMV lease is true renting with a lower payment and a walk-away or market-price purchase at the end. Long keepers usually do better with $1-buyout or a straight financed purchase; frequent upgraders fit FMV.

What is an evergreen clause in an equipment lease?

An automatic-renewal provision - and most copier leases have one. If you do not send written notice inside the window, commonly 90 days before term end, the lease renews itself, typically for another 12 months at the same or higher payment. Courts routinely enforce them in commercial contracts. Calendar the notice date the day you sign.

Is 100% bonus depreciation back?

Yes - permanently. The 2025 tax law restored 100% bonus depreciation for qualifying equipment acquired and placed in service after January 19, 2025, killing the old 80/60/40/20 phase-down schedule that many articles still describe. One catch: several states do not follow the federal rule for state income tax, and this guide's state table shows where yours stands.
